Output 53876ce756061cbb46dcebbe953cde4f21b30374f6bb4369123d55446b243f69:1

value
20710485
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b293b2120093ea3b44c8cd57497124e8f49ad834 OP_EQUALVERIFY OP_CHECKSIG
address
1HHEDDUfJJU7hptEnqLSH9VtUe2QqA3LG9
transaction
53876ce756061cbb46dcebbe953cde4f21b30374f6bb4369123d55446b243f69
spent
true